Chinese men's volleyball closer to Athens
|
Chinese men's volleyball team beat
Iran 3-1 in qualifiers for Athens Olympic Games held in Tokyo,
Japan on May 25. Till now China has had three wins in a row.
The scores of the four sets are 25-16, 25-23, 31-33 and 25-22.
The Chinese team, seeking for their first Olympic qualifying slot in 20 years, started strong in the match, winning the first two sets 25-16, 25-22 thanks to strong attacking and tight blocking.
But they lost concentration in the third set after leading 23-17 and the Iranian team, which trounced South Korea 3-0 on Monday,took advantage to launch a strong comeback.
The Chinese team squandered eight match points before losing the set 31-33.
In the fourth set, the Chinese team held their nerve to wrap upthe match 25-22.
"We lost concentration in the third set. We should have concluded the match 3-0," said Chinese head coach Di An'he. "Yes we have won three matches, but the next matches will be much tougher for us."
China will play France on Wednesday and then meet Canada, Australia and Algeria later this week.
France now top the standings after beating South Korea 3-0 on Tuesday. The French team have not dropped a single set so far in the tournament.
Only the winners and the top ranked Asian team of the tournament qualify for the 2004 Athens Olympic Games.
China lost to Iran in Busan Asian Games. Iranian team members are good jumpers with excellent individual ability but rough tactic and technique. With new Korean coach, the team has improved in style.
China will play against the strongest rival France tomorrow.
